		<description>While I agree with you regarding Dan Sullivan, I object to your opinion of the parks in Anchorage.  Anchorage has great parks, trails, etc.  IMHO, much better than those in Austin (I lived there for the better part of a decade).  And Jewel Lake really is a jewel in the heart of Anchorage - my husband and I live just down the street and often portage our canoe to the lake for a quick paddle in the midst of loons, grebes, ducks, geese, and a muskrat or two.  Every nice evening and weekend there are people fishing on the south bank, barbequing at the park, or swimming in the marked-off swim area (the only one I&#039;m familiar with in Anchorage proper other than at Goose lake).  Jewel Lake is even used by the local rowing club for their regattas.  I&#039;m not sure how long it&#039;s been since you&#039;ve been to Anchorage parks, but your description of Jewel Lake could not be more wrong.</description>

		<description>merely electing left wingers doesn&#039;t necessarily help.  sullivan&#039;s predecessor, now US senator mark begich was equally complicit in the NIMBY-ism that has locked up this part of anchorage&#039;s coastline -- as well as being an active participant in overdevelopment.  his administration greased the wheels for 130 acres of sprawl retail in mt view and muldoon, on the northeast periphery of town.  the new malls were carved out of undeveloped, forested land; some of it held by a muni agency called the heritage land bank.</description>
